Gluesenkamp Perez Tours U.S. Army Corps of Engineers Dredging Vessel on the Columbia River

Rep. Gluesenkamp Perez tours the hopper dredge Yaquina on the Columbia River.

Last week, Rep. Marie Gluesenkamp Perez (WA-03) toured the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) hopper dredge Yaquina along with local port and trade leaders to see the dredging process firsthand and discuss how she can support operations along the Columbia River at the federal level.

The USACE Portland District’s Yaquina, and larger Essayons, operated by Merchant Marine crews, help to maintain entrance bars, rivers, and harbors vital to the passage of maritime trade in the region. On the tour, the Congresswoman visited the bridge, engine room, and hopper, and spoke with crew members about yearly maintenance, federal funding needs, and staffing and operations.

“With billions of dollars of cargo moving through our shipping channels each year, the hard work of dredging crews is essential for keeping our waterways safe and navigable and our economy moving full steam ahead,” said Rep. Gluesenkamp Perez. “I enjoyed joining the crew of the Yaquina to see the impressive amount of institutional knowledge that keeps their vessel running and hear how we can best support operations and streamline maintenance needs.”

Rep. Gluesenkamp Perez has visited 13 ports across Southwest Washington, held roundtables on trade and maritime transportation, and joined the Columbia River Bar Pilots in September to see their work ensuring safe passage of cargo.

In April, the Congresswoman led a group of her colleagues to urge the prioritization of funding to complete the South Jetty at the mouth of the Columbia River. She also successfully helped ensure a critical weather buoy at the mouth of the Columbia River was repaired, and is urging NOAA to service another inoperable buoy.
